Position: Laborer I
Department: Animal Services
Reports To: Animal Services Manager
FLSA Status: Non-Exempt
Pay: $13.65/hour
DESCRIPTION
Performs all aspects of humane animal care duties to ensure animal safety and well-being and provides quality customer service by providing the public with assistance and accurate information regarding Animal Services' policies, programs, and procedures.
QUALIFICATIONS
- High school diploma or equivalent required; associate degree or coursework in animal science, veterinary technology, or related field preferred.
- Previous experience working with animals in a shelter, veterinary clinic, or animal care facility preferred.
- Must possess a valid Driver's License Class C at time of placement.
- Must complete and pass Basic Certification Course required by Texas Department of Health and Euthanasia Certification within the first 6 months of employment.
KNOWLEDGE, SKILLS, AND ABILITIES
- Knowledge of animal behavior, handling techniques, and basic animal care principles, with a commitment to providing compassionate and humane treatment to animals.
- Skills in excellent interpersonal communication, with the ability to interact professionally and courteously with diverse individuals, including staff, volunteers, animal owners, and the general public.
- Skills in basic computer usage and ability to learn shelter management software.
- Ability to work effectively in a fast-paced, physically demanding environment, including lifting and carrying animals, bending, stooping, and standing for extended periods.
- Ability to work in adverse weather conditions.
MAJOR DUTIES
- Cleans, disinfects, and maintains shelter area as assigned.
- Feeds, water, bathes, dips, and exercises animals. Provides humane sheltering services in compliance with State Minimum standards and shelter policies.
- Safely and humanely handle animals of unknown health and temperament.
- Assists in monitoring the medical/behavioral status of animals and performs related health care activities.
- Must be able to perform euthanasia as a function of shelter operations.
- Ensures the safety of animals and people in the shelter.
- Accurately maintains all required records in the shelter's database.
- Provides information to the public.
- Transfers animals between kennels and cages using proper handling procedures.
- Interface with the public and respond to citizen inquiries and concerns.
- May supervise the work assigned to community service workers.
- Other duties as assigned.
This position is an essential service position and will require providing services during emergency situations.
